#cc1d46 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c1d46 is composed of 80% red, 11.4%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.8% magenta, 65.7%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 345.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 45.7%. #cc1d46 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3a8c with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#cc1d46 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cc1d46 has RGB values of R:204, G:29,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.66,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13376838.

Shades and Tints of #cc1d46
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0205 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c1d46
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b6e71 is the less saturated color, while #e70238 is the most saturated one.
